by William Shakespeare
Othello, a Moorish general in Venice, falls victim to the manipulations of his ensign Iago, whose lies poison Othello's love for Desdemona and drive him to murderous jealousy. Shakespeare explores themes of race, trust, and the destructive power of jealousy in one of his most psychologically intense tragedies. A timeless examination of how love and honor can be corrupted by suspicion.
